E150a (Class I / Plain Caramel) is produced by controlled thermal heating of food carbohydrates without ammonium or sulfite compounds. INS 150a, ADI is Not Specified, yielding a warm brown-amber color in spirits, whiskey, and vinegars.
E202 (Potassium Sorbate) is the potassium salt of sorbic acid, offering 58% water solubility at room temperature. INS 202, group ADI is 11 mg/kg bw/day, widely utilized in beverages, syrups, and cosmetics to block yeast fermentation.
